Q: How do I get into the temporary site at Marlow Wharf during the Penhale House renovation?

A: Night shift uses the side entrance on the loading dock, not the main lobby — it's locked after 20:00. Badge readers aren't wired up yet at the temporary site, so the keypad is the only way in. Check the rota board for your supervisor's sign-in sheet. The door code for the dock entrance is below.

door code, yagap-bahof: bdg-O-05

Minutes — Management Meeting (Sales Leads)

Topic: Q3 Budget Request

Denna presented the ask: extra headcount for the Larkspur accounts and a bump to the travel line. Finance pushed back a bit on the events spend, so we trimmed it. Revised figures go to Orvan by Friday. Sales leads should hold commitments until sign-off. The thinking behind the reallocation is set out below.

internal memo for haduf-fajeg: Headcount on the Quenwyn team goes from 7 to 80 by the end of July. Gross margin on Quenwyn came in at 10 percent against a plan of 15 percent.

**Ticket: Config drift on ContrastCheck audit runner**

Hey Marisol — the color-contrast audit job on Quillbird staging is flagging different WCAG thresholds than prod, so the accessibility report for the 4.2 release doesn't match what QA signed off. Looks like someone hand-edited the staging audit config back in March and it never got synced. Before we re-run, here's what staging is currently using.

settings of bafof-fajog:
[aldix]
port = 9300
region = north-3
host = aldix.kelvilabs.example
team = istath
timeout_ms = 1500
retries = 8

## Changelog — Pairgrid 3.2: GC defaults changed

Matching latency spikes traced to long garbage-collection pauses under burst load. We switched the Pairgrid matcher to the low-pause collector and reduced heap headroom; p99 pause dropped from 800ms to 40ms in load tests. Plugin authors: if you embed the matcher SDK, your callbacks may now fire more frequently with smaller batches. Override only if you have measured a regression. The new defaults shipping with 3.2 are listed below.

settings of kagup-tagug:
ULAIX_HOST=ulaix.zemvarsys.internal
ULAIX_PORT=8000